NOTE 🛑 The plugin does not currently support the WooCommerce Blocks checkout. To use this plugin you need to have a normal checkout page that has the [woocommerce_checkout] shortcode. If you’re setting up a brand new website with a fresh version of WooCommerce installed on it, then by default, WooCommerce will create your checkout page as a Blocks checkout page. For this plugin to work, you need to delete all contents of that blocks page and add the shortcode: [woocommerce_checkout] inside it. You can see this link for reverting to classic checkout WooCommerce doc Once thats done you’ll have the normal WooCommerce checkout page and the plugin options will show. Still need help? How Can Location Picker At Checkout for WooCommerce Help Me? Kikote is a Checkout Location Picker plugin for WooCommerce that is suitable for any website that offers Delivery or Pickups for their customers. A Delivery website example would be an online restaurant, a Pickup website example would be a private taxi website. The plugin adds a Google map on the WooCommerce checkout page that customers can use to select their desired location. Alternatively, the plugin can be set up to also allow it to automatically detect the customer’s location on checkout page load and allow them to make any corrections Kikote – Location Picker at Checkout makes use of the Google Maps API to carry out it’s functions; it can work as any of the following: ✅ WooCommerce Checkout Map Plugin This plugin adds a Google Map to the checkout page of WooCommerce which customers can use to select their location whether for deliveries or pickups. ✅ WooCommerce Billing & Shipping Address AutoFill Plugin Kikote can work as a checkout address autofill for WooCommerce making it a full-featured autocomplete address and location picker for WooCommerce plugin. It can automatically fill in the WooCommerce checkout fields with the information pulled from the Google map or from the Google Places API. Save users some typing while pulling accurate address information. ✅ WooCommerce Shipping Zones (Regions) by Drawing Plugin Kikote comes with a PREMIUM Shipping Zones by Drawing feature for WooCommerce which lets store owners draw custom shipping regions. Drawn shipping regions can have a name, price and background color. It’s also possible to display the shipping regions on the checkout page’s google map so customers can see the cost for shipping to different regions. During checkout, if a customer location falls within a shipping region, the cost set for that shipping region will automatically be set as the shipping fee for the customer. Create as many shipping zones and draw as many shipping regions as you like. Kikote will automatically set the cost of the shipping method once a customer falls within those drawn regions. Location Picker at Checkout for WooCommerce also allows store owners to enable the Places autocomplete feature on their checkout address fields. This feature shows customers address predictions as they type in their address. When a customer clicks the desired address from the dropdown, it can also automatically fill in the rest of the checkout fields. This feature is also known as Google Address Autofill. ✅ Saved Addresses for WooCommerce Plugin Allow customers to save multiple different addresses to their account that they can select from when placing an order. Configuring Plugin: The plugin settings are located in WordPress Admin Dashboard->SoaringLeads->Kikote – Location Picker At Checkout. Plugin Documentation You can find the plugin documentation Here >>> Shortcodes [kikote_store_selector] – Adds a store selector dropdown that lets user’s choose their preferred store to order from. [kikote_map id='x'] – Adds a custom Google Map that you’ve created using the Map Builder anywhere on your website. The ID for the map can be retrieved from within the Map Builder screen.
